NettetIrma was the first major (Category 3 or higher) hurricane to make landfall in South Florida since Wilma of 2005. The highest wind gust recorded on land in South Florida was 142 mph at a mesonet site near Naples Airport. The highest sustained wind recorded was 112 mph by a spotter on Marco Island. Sustained wind at Orlando International Airport peaked at 59 mph, short of the 74 mph of a minimal hurricane. When was Hurricane Irma the strongest? The storm became a rare category-5 hurricane on September 5 th, with maximum sustained winds of 185 MPH. great day personal care home
